JOB TITLE - Counselor

 

CLASSIFICATION - Certified

FLSA STATUS - Exempt

 

IMMEDIATE SUPERVISOR - Building Principal

 

RECEIVES GUIDANCE FROM - Building administrators, district leadership

 

PURPOSE OF THE POSITION - The Urbandale counselors work cooperatively with parents, teachers, administrators and the Urbandale Community in providing needed social/emotional support and direction to students.  Counselors strive to ensure that all students have a positive school experience in which they develop a healthy self-esteem, the skills to interact and communicate productively in a global and technological society, and the maturity to make wise decisions in their daily lives and future planning.  It is the counseling goal to encourage and nurture students as life-long learners, to use their unique potential in constructive, responsible and satisfying ways.

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ES

The following duties are normal for this position.  These are not to be construed as exclusive or all inclusive.  Other duties may be required and assigned.

  1. Demonstrates effective implementation of the ASCA Mindsets and Behaviors in a comprehensive school counseling program.
  2. Implements 'quality' principles and tools to create student-centered learning environments and improve overall quality and meaningfulness of learning opportunities.
  3. Establish rapport with children through informal contacts.
  4. Work with individual children in a counseling setting using techniques that apply to the age/development of the child.
  5. Provide crisis counseling in times of need.
  6. Provide small group counseling with students using various methods
  7. Provide developmental classroom guidance to all students focusing on areas such as: acceptance of self, effective communication, coping skills, problem solving skills, understanding feelings, reducing racial/ethnic stereotyping, peer relationships, family relationships, substance abuse and dealing with loss.
  8. Assist teachers in developing a team approach to planning and implementation college and career readiness and social, emotional, behavior, and mental health supports in the classroom.
  9. Assist in orientation of new students in the school and its procedures.
  10. Provide follow-up on individual referrals.
  11. Initiate and administer 504 plans in collaboration with the Dean of Students.
  12. Consult with staff members involving case studies/staffing in an effort to bring about a better adjustment for each child.
  13. Consult with teachers individually concerning the child's progress.
  14. Consult with teachers to develop management strategies to meet the needs of individual students.
  15. Maintain a working knowledge of the testing program, supporting State Assessment planning
  16. Ability to make parental contacts and set up visits to increase parent awareness to the programs available to students.
  17. Consult with educational specialists such as school psychologists, learning disabilities specialists, AEA specialists, social service and mental health specialists.
  18. Consult with community referral agencies.
  19. Consult with parents to provide opportunities for their participation in parent education programs.
  20. Promote positive attitudes and awareness of the guidance program within the school district/community.
  21. Conduct assessment of the students’ needs/concerns using various instruments, such as: inventories, surveys of staff and community and sociograms.
  22. Be an active member in professional organizations.
  23. Meets professional responsibilities as outlined in the Professional Growth Assessment Plan, Employee Handbook, and Board policy.
  24. Develops, with supervisor, a plan for professional growth.
  25. Maintain a reliable attendance record.
  26. Perform other duties as assigned.
